Used to shoot square stance ever since i started umtil recently whem i switched to open. However, i find the open stance causes my bow arm shoulder to roll over and have a shitty alignment :/
@OnlineArcheryAcademy
4 жыл бұрын
It can be harder to get that bow shoulder alignment as I mentioned in the video, but it's always a trade off with other factors too. It's always good to practice getting the alignment in the mirror with a band and no shirt on, and then you can start to get the feeling of the torso rotation a bit more clearly to help with that alignment.

I found open stance more consistent but that doesn't permit me to do the bow rotation after the shot (as most of Corean do). Is such rotatoin important?
@OnlineArcheryAcademy
3 жыл бұрын
The amount of rotation itself isn't important, it's more important that you don't grip and/or torque the bow. So if you feel a good bow hand release with the open stance but it doesn't do the full rotation this can be fine - an example is some archers release and have the bow tip hit the leg.
